Does the Dodge Caliber SRT4 have a turbo?

Yes. The Dodge Caliber SRT-4 uses a factory turbocharged 2.4-liter inline-four, delivering far more power than the standard Caliber lineup.


Turbocharged under the hood: how it works


The Caliber SRT-4 refines the 2.4-liter World engine with a single turbocharger and intercooler. This setup increases air density into the engine, allowing more fuel to burn and producing substantially more horsepower than the naturally aspirated versions. The SRT-4 also features a close-ratio 6-speed manual and performance-tuned suspension to transmit that power to the front wheels.


Engine family and tuning


Key technical specs of the turbocharged powertrain include the following:



  • Engine: 2.4-liter turbocharged inline-four from the Chrysler World engine family

  • Turbo/intercooler: single turbocharger with air-to-air intercooler

  • Output: roughly 285 horsepower and about 260 lb-ft of torque

  • Drivetrain: front-wheel drive with a 6-speed manual transmission

  • Production years: the SRT-4 variant was offered for 2008 and 2009 model years


The combination of turbocharged power, a manual transmission, and aggressive chassis tuning gave the Caliber SRT-4 a unique place in the hot-hatch landscape of its era.


Performance snapshot and historical context


Owners and automotive observers often highlight the Caliber SRT-4 as a sleeper: a practical five-door hatchback with performance credentials that rivaled some dedicated sports cars of its time.


Performance highlights



  1. 0-60 mph time is typically cited in the mid-5-second range, depending on conditions and launch technique

  2. Estimated top speed around 140 mph

  3. Notable for its aggressive exhaust note and front-wheel-drive handling characteristics

  4. Production ended after 2009, making well-maintained examples relatively rare today


In practice, the turbocharged engine and the SRT-4's chassis work together to deliver a compelling blend of daily usability and weekend-warrior performance.
